69D Mount Ephraim — sold price history

69D Mount Ephraim appears in the HM Land Registry record 6 times, first in Sep 1999 and most recently in Apr 2019. Every figure below is the price actually paid on completion.

SoldPrice paidIn today's moneyTypeTenure
17 Sep 1999£87,500£178,288Flat or maisonetteLeasehold
28 Apr 2003£164,800£311,485Flat or maisonetteLeasehold
18 Nov 2005£167,500£305,136Flat or maisonetteLeasehold
13 Feb 2014£187,500£268,947Flat or maisonetteLeasehold
24 Jun 2016£240,000£335,050Flat or maisonetteLeasehold
8 Apr 2019£255,000£333,534Flat or maisonetteLeasehold
Every recorded sale of this address.

Between 1999 and 2019 the recorded price moved from £87,500 to £255,000 — +5.5% a year in cash, and +3.2% a year once inflation is removed. In 2026 money the earlier sale is worth £178,288.

To have held its value since that sale, this address would need to fetch £333,534 today. Anything less is a loss in real terms, however the cash price has moved. It is the number no listing shows.
